Introduction to Windows AI Studio

Windows AI Studio is a comprehensive platform designed to simplify the development process of generative AI applications. It offers developers access to a wide range of advanced AI tools and pre-trained models from trusted sources such as the Azure AI Studio Catalog and Hugging Face.

Key Features

Browse and Access Models: Developers can explore a diverse collection of AI models supported by both Azure ML and Hugging Face. This includes state-of-the-art language, vision, and audio models that can be integrated into various applications.

Download and Local Operations: Users have the ability to download selected models directly onto their local machines. This enables offline work and ensures data privacy compliance in certain environments.

Model Fine-tuning

Customization Capabilities: Windows AI Studio allows developers to fine-tune pre-trained models according to specific project requirements. This feature is particularly useful for creating tailored solutions that meet unique business needs.

Testing and Validation

Comprehensive Testing Suite: The platform includes robust testing tools to evaluate model performance. Developers can assess accuracy, efficiency, and other critical metrics before deploying the models into production environments.

Integration with Windows Applications

Simplified Integration Process: Once tested and validated, developers can seamlessly integrate these fine-tuned models into their Windows-based applications. This integration process is designed to be user-friendly, ensuring that even less experienced developers can implement AI solutions effectively.

Performance Considerations

Local Computation Requirements: All computations are performed locally to ensure faster processing and reduce latency. Developers are advised to ensure their hardware meets the necessary specifications to handle intensive AI workloads efficiently.

Future Enhancements

ORT/DML Integration: Windows AI Studio is planning to incorporate ORT (Open Runtime) and DML (DirectML) into its workflow. This integration will allow developers to run AI models on a wider range of Windows hardware, including devices with varying computational capabilities.

Target Audience

Primary Users: The platform is primarily aimed at software developers who are looking to incorporate generative AI capabilities into their Windows applications. This includes both individual developers and teams working on enterprise-level projects.
